A FRESH PERSPECTIVE: Michael Rider’s first show as creative director for Celine felt like a fashion reset, making way for a confident and polished preppy-chic look. The show was packed with wearable trends, the clothes leaned into structure with ease: sharp-shouldered coats, shirting with exaggerated collars (layered over white form-fitting polo-necks), clean-cut pressedfront jeans and tailored trousers. But it was the accessory styling that did the real talking. Jewellery was boldly piled on without being loud: think layered charm necklaces, XL chain bracelets, stacked rings. There were patterned silk scarves and plenty of belts and brooches – yet nothing felt overdone. Rider’s message was clear: modern dressing is about attitude and knowing exactly how much is just enough …
